Research

Our research covers many aspects of software engineering and programming languages. In particular, we focus on domain-specific languages, software configuration, and constraint programming. We employ formalized theories, develop open-source tools, and apply empirical research methods.

Teaching

The institute represents the areas software engineering and programming languages in the bachelor and master programs of computer science and related fields. We offer the following mandatory courses in the Bachelor's program:

  • Interactive Systems Programming
  • Software Engineering
  • Software Project

Furthermore, we are responsible for the bachelor and master program Software Engineering.
